Product Overview
The Weiman Cookware Cleaner is a non-abrasive formula that gently yet effectively cleans and polishes cookware without damaging its surface. It is ideal for stainless steel, aluminum, as well as non-stick cooking vessels.
Ease of Use
The Weiman Cookware Cleaner is easy to use with a simple direct application onto the cooking pan at a cool temperature. Followed by a gentle scrub, then rinse and dry the pan. No elaborate setup or preparation is required, making it user-friendly.

Scent and Residue
Unlike most heavy chemical-based cleaners, Weiman has a mild, fresh scent that doesn’t overpower or linger after cleaning. Moreover, it does not leave behind any residue or streaks when properly rinsed, maintaining the aesthetic appeal of your cookware.
